No traffic road cycling routes around Aubière benefit from the region's diverse topography, ranging from the flat plains of the Limagne to undulating hills. The area is characterized by its proximity to the Chaîne des Puys, a volcanic landscape offering varied ascents and descents. Cyclists can also find routes following river courses like the Artière, providing gentler gradients. This mix of terrain ensures a range of road cycling experiences.

The no traffic road cycling routes around Aubière offer incredibly varied landscapes. You'll encounter the dramatic volcanic terrain of the Chaîne des Puys, a UNESCO World Heritage site, providing challenging ascents and panoramic views. Other routes wind through the flat plains of the Limagne, past charming villages, and alongside rivers like the Allier, offering a mix of scenery for every cyclist.
Yes, many of the no traffic road cycling routes around Aubière are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. For example, the Chapelle Saint-Aubin – View of the Puy de Dome loop from Royat - Chamalières offers a moderate 29.4 km ride with stunning views. Another option is the Gergovia Plateau – Gergovie Plateau loop from Clermont - La Pardieu, covering 27.4 km.

Absolutely. For experienced cyclists seeking a challenge, Aubière and its surroundings offer difficult no traffic road cycling routes, especially those venturing into the Chaîne des Puys. These routes feature significant elevation gains and demanding climbs. An example is the Côte de Berzet – Col de la Moréno (1065 m) loop from Ceyrat, a difficult 83.6 km route with over 1500 meters of elevation gain.

While this guide focuses on routes around Aubière, the broader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es region boasts an extensive network of cycling routes, including shared paths and greenways. These networks, such as the 'Via Allier' or parts of EuroVelo routes, offer opportunities for long-distance no traffic cycling, connecting diverse landscapes from volcanoes to river valleys.
